HMS Fitzroy

Dates: 1943 - 1946

The HMS Fitzroy was a Destroyer ship, which belonged to the Captain Class Frigates of ships.

The ship had a displacement of 1430 Tons and was launched from the Bethlehem shipyard, on 01/09/1943.

The ship was the 2nd of the line, the 1st was a Survey ship, Later a ’Hunt’ class minesweeper launched by Lobnitz on 15/04/1919.
Originally PINNER then PORTREATH. Sunk by mine off Gt. Yarmouth 27/05/1942.

The ship was on lend lease from the US Navy and was returned on 05/01/1946.
